Calamity was such a fun, quick read! I thought the world building and characters (especially the crew) were the strongest parts of the story, although I did enjoy the plot and the consistent humor. I was a little concerned when the cult appeared fairly early on (not my favorite thing to read), but while the cult plays a role in the plot, it’s mostly secondary to other things going on. My least favorite part was actually the romance - it didn’t quite work for me even though I wanted it to. I think a large part of that was how Temperance and Arcadio never really felt like enemies, despite the story repeatedly telling us they were supposed to be. 
 
Overall, though, this was a fairly strong novel that I felt was fairly balanced in world building, characters, plot, and intrigue. This is the author’s debut novel-length work and I’m looking forward to seeing what comes next! Thank you again to the publisher for sending me a free ARC.
